How they compare
Afghanistan currently reports 0.9% against 0.6% in Mozambique, a difference of 0.3%.
That makes Afghanistan's figure about 1.5 times Mozambique's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 11 shared years of data; in 1960 it was Mozambique ahead.
Afghanistan ranks 140th and Mozambique ranks 141st of 144 countries.
Across the 6 decades both report, Afghanistan averaged higher in 3 and Mozambique in 1.
